S A C K C L O T H S

 

To truly have the wonderful experience of fasting one is to truly be devoted to keeping his or her fast as pleasing unto the Lord.  After you have selected  fasting dates the next step is the length of time you want to keep the fast;  along with a fasting location.  If it possible,  have your fast from interuptions.  This does not mean you cannot carry on everyday duties, but a more "potent steady fast" would be to have your fast alone if at all possible in a certain place.

Search:  Find a place, or time away from the every day routines you do if this is possible.  If not, set aside the number of hours you will fast and have that time designated to keeping your mediation and fast pure.  As for food; and or water intake, you can set them in hours, all day, half days, certain limited hours of a day or weeks.

  Have the meditation and prayers uninterrupted and in secret.   When you have outlined the basics of the timing you are almost ready to begin to encounter a most extraordinary force of God's presence with your spirit.  Good planning aids in your fast lasting and attributes to your sincerity to carry it through.   Patience is virtue, so be seriously thinking of this time with God.   I'll return with more tips on Tuesday, April 14, 2015.  Until then prepare you mind for meditation fasting and prayers with the suggestions I'll give in the Sackcloths.
